At its core, STWA: Unbroken presents a fascinating near-future premise. The world has been revolutionized by advanced neural implants that can record, store, and perfectly recreate every human sense. Imagine tasting a meal you ate years ago or feeling a sunset’s warmth on a winter night—that’s the everyday reality in this setting. This technology birthed immersive virtual worlds, or “Servers,” where people escape to live out fantasies ranging from medieval kingdoms to cyberpunk metropolises. 🧠✨ But as you’ll quickly learn, this shiny utopia has a massive, jagged crack running right through it. The story doesn’t shy away from the grim underside of such power: black markets dealing in illicit sensory recordings, psychological addiction to curated realities, and the profound erosion of what’s “real.” This isn’t just backdrop; it’s the fertile ground from which the game’s gripping STWA: Unbroken plot grows.

How Neural Implants Change Everything

This is where STWA: Unbroken truly separates itself from the pack. The neural implant game premise is what transforms it from a great story into a revolutionary piece of interactive fiction. It’s not just a cool sci-fi idea; it’s the engine for unparalleled immersion.

The game constantly reminds you of this technology’s presence and implications. When a character shares a “memory,” you’re not just reading a description; the narrative puts you directly into that sensory experience. The writing becomes richer, focusing on the scent of rain on concrete, the specific texture of fabric, or the distant echo of a forgotten song. This makes every shared memory a moment of profound vulnerability or intimacy, deepening character bonds in a way simple dialogue never could. Conversely, the threat of having your own senses hacked or recorded creates a unique layer of paranoia and tension.

From a gameplay perspective, it also influences the choice system. Some choices are less about what you say and more about what you feel or which senses you prioritize in a given moment. Do you focus on analyzing the subtle micro-expressions of a business rival, or do you let yourself get lost in the ambiance of a location to gather a different kind of intel? It adds a fascinating strategic layer to interactions.

To see how this focus elevates the experience, let’s compare it to more common AVN tropes:

Aspect Typical Mainstream AVN Focus STWA: Unbroken’s Focus via Neural Implants
Immersion Visual appeal, choice-driven dialogue. Full sensory engagement. The story is built on the impact of taste, touch, smell, and sound, making the world physically tangible.
Conflict Often interpersonal drama or simple external threats. Existential & philosophical. Conflicts revolve around the nature of reality, identity, and the ethics of experience itself.
Character Bonding Shared activities and conversations. Shared sensory reality. Bonds are formed by literally sharing pieces of one’s past subjective experience, creating deeper, more visceral connections.
